Ready to Power a Smarter World with us? In the role of Senior Digital Business Program Manager working onsite in Waukesha, Wisconsin you will be part of the Digital Business Office team. The Senior Program Manager manages medium-to-large-scale cross-functional technology programs enabling business transformation and value realization. This individual works with the business and technology leaders to develop outcomes based program roadmaps and manages the delivery of it. Major Responsibilities Works with various project stakeholders to define program and project(s) scope, requirements and outcomes Partners with the business stakeholders as needed to shape business cases with clear value metrics Manages the relationship with project team and stakeholders Coordinates with cross functional teams - including software development teams, business owners, security experts, and external partners to deliver on program goals Assists or leads planning and execution of testing sessions as needed Ensures successful completion of assigned programs within the budgeted time and cost constraints Drives timely delivery by setting and communicating milestones, and by ensuring adequate resource availability and effective allocation throughout the project lifecycle Measures project performance using appropriate systems, tools and techniques Uses appropriate verification techniques to manage changes in project scope, schedule and costs Creates and maintains comprehensive project documentation Creates and maintains comprehensive plans, ensuring clear communication and regular status updates to stakeholders Contributes to the maturity of Program Management discipline Minimum Job Requirements Education Bachelor's degree in information systems or related field, or equivalent work experience Certification / License PMP AI certifications Work Experience 8 years of large-scale project and program management and a background in implementing AI & Agentic AI based solutions Knowledge / Skills / Abilities Owns multiple interconnected programs simultaneously, spanning org-wide AI strategies with higher ambiguity and broader business impact Proven track record of successful planning and leading large technology initiatives with ownership across Scope-Schedule-Budget & Quality of outcomes Experience with implementing multi-year, large and complex technology initiatives in manufacturing industry Working knowledge of IOT based data capture and leveraging data to drive insights, decisions and transformative customer experiences Experience and expertise with leveraging AI, Gen-AI and Agentic AI in delivering transformative end2end scalable experiences Demonstrated ability to deliver results while working on multiple projects simultaneously, balancing priorities, timing and quality of outcomes Demonstrated success in influencing people and teams who are not all direct reports Strong verbal/written communication skills Confident and self-motivated individual, with a dedicated approach Strong ability to prioritize focus on initiatives by negotiating priorities based on business value and deliver in a high-paced environment Ability to learn new technology applications and process techniques quickly Working Knowledge of Waterfall and Agile Life Cycles methodologies Experience leverage JIRA to plan and manage work Preferred Job Requirements Education Program Management & Change Management Certification / License Agile Program Management certification preferred but not required Work Experience Experience with managing large transformations with AI infused transformative customer journeys and solutions Experience in building and managing Roadmaps and Program Schedule in Jira or similar project management tools Experience with leading Customer Experience End to End Journey Mapping Experience with large Data and Integration Projects Knowledge / Skills / Abilities Ability to read and provide insight to journey maps #LI-BB1
